摘要

The inner chamber of an electric furnace, a tank of depot is loaded of a bed of the molten materials produced from boric acid as a fine grains of oxides has fine grains of the metal base and or of the metal base into small pieces, as well as of the carriers of carbon and which forms the - the top of the zone of the reduction of a layer forming a bed of the permeable to gases. The boron alloy is collected and taken off on the floor of the furnace. The process is applied to the production of a boron alloy based on cobalt and or of a boron alloy based on nickel. The bed of fusion with a carrier of carbon is constituted by the wood pieces 2 a 250mm is a quantity of 20 to 65, provided at the total quantity of carbon. The layer forming a bed of melting is maintained at a thickness of at least 500mm in which the wood is coked a dry wood charcoal.
